Begey Aground

The 86 meter long, 1649 dwt freighter Begey loaded with 1587 metric tons of general cargo went aground on the Volga Caspian Sea Canal near the 153.5 kilometer mark.   The freighter was later refloated the same day by the icebreaker Kapitan Bukaev.  The Begey proceeded to Olya for to be surveyed for any damage.  No reports of injuries or pollution being released.  The grounding was due to ice shove.
